  4. Shooters prefer clear or yellow lens colors for shooting. Yellow is great for daytime and well-lit conditions because it enhances contrast and visual acuity. Clear lenses are best if you may be shooting at night.
  5. Those who use bifocals will find a conundrum when purchasing shooting glasses. They want to be able to sight without any distractions, but they also may need their near vision occasionally. We find that the best solution to this is to get either no bifocal or a lined bifocal with an extremely low segment height (about 6mm) so that the bifocal is there if you need it and out of the way the rest of the time.

With very high prescriptions, the optics are better on flat frames than wraparounds, so those who need strong correction will want to browse our flat frames selection for shooting glasses.
